How to check the disk group and directory size on the Oracle ASM disk for CAD or PTMS

The CAD or PTMS database usually is structured by Oracle RAC with shared storage.

The Oracle ASM disk is created on the shared storage, and all the archive log backup and oracle tablespace data files locate on it.

To check the disk space usage rate, we need to log onto the ASM disk:

 # su - grid

> asmcmd

ASMCMD> lsdg

State    Type    Rebal  Sector  Block       AU  Total_MB  Free_MB  Req_mir_free_MB  Usable_file_MB  Offline_disks  Voting_files  Name

MOUNTED  EXTERN  N         512   4096  1048576    204800   204427                0          204427              0             N  DG_BACKUP/

MOUNTED  EXTERN  N         512   4096  1048576    307200   295154                0          295154              0             N  DG_DATA/

MOUNTED  EXTERN  N         512   4096  1048576    102400   102305                0          102305              0             N  DG_INDEX/

MOUNTED  EXTERN  N         512   4096  1048576     20480    20084                0           20084              0             Y  DG_OCR/

MOUNTED  EXTERN  N         512   4096  1048576    122880    71388                0           71388              0             N  DG_ORA/

ASMCMD>


ASMCMD>

ASMCMD> cd dg_backup

ASMCMD> cd IPCC/ARCHIVELOG

ASMCMD> ls

2019_06_12/

ASMCMD> du

Used_MB      Mirror_used_MB

    269                 269

ASMCMD>
